Title transfer involves transferring ownership of a vehicle from one party to another. In Nevada, this process typically requires the completion of specific forms and submission of necessary documentation to the DMV.
To be eligible for online title transfer in Nevada, individuals must meet certain criteria, such as having a valid driver's license, owning the vehicle outright, and ensuring all liens on the vehicle have been satisfied.
When completing an online title transfer, individuals will need to provide various documents, including the vehicle's current title, bill of sale, odometer reading, and proof of identity.
To ensure a smooth online title transfer process, it's essential to double-check all information entered, upload clear copies of required documents, and follow any instructions provided by the DMV.
Common mistakes to avoid during online title transfer include providing incorrect information, failing to upload required documents, and neglecting to pay transfer fees promptly. These mistakes can delay the processing of your application.
When completing an online title transfer, it's crucial to prioritize security and accuracy to protect sensitive personal and financial information. Be sure to use secure internet connections and verify the authenticity of the DMV website.
Fees for online title transfer in Nevada may vary depending on factors such as the vehicle's value and the type of transfer being conducted. Check the Nevada DMV website for current fee schedules and payment options.

Can I transfer a title online if there is a lien on the vehicle?
In most cases, titles with liens cannot be transferred online. Contact the lienholder for instructions on how to proceed with the title transfer.
How long does it take to receive the new title after completing an online transfer?
Processing times for online title transfers vary, but most individuals receive their new titles within a few weeks of submitting the application.
What should I do if I make a mistake on my online title transfer application?
If you make a mistake on your application, contact the Nevada DMV immediately to request corrections. Avoid submitting incorrect information, as it may delay the processing of your application.
Can I transfer a title online if I am not a resident of Nevada?
Online title transfer services may be limited to Nevada residents. Non-residents should contact the DMV for guidance on transferring titles in their home state.
